Optimistic Murray ‘going in the right direction’

Andy Murray headed for home yesterday feeling his tennis is “going in the right direction” despite his Australian Open final defeat by Novak Djokovic.

The Serbian became the first man in the Open era to claim three successive Melbourne crowns by seeing off Murray in four sets – and also gained revenge for his US Open final defeat to the Scot in September.

Murray has cut a forlorn figure after his previous Grand Slam final defeats but he was more upbeat on this occasion as he looked forward with optimism to the rest of the season.
